    Abstract
    This study aims to determine the effect of inquiry based observation of physic phenomena model on science generic skills and cognitive abilities of physic science of students junior high school. The population of this study was a class VII student of SMP Negeri 11 Jember. The sample was the X A grade students of 38 as a experimental group and the X B students of 38 as an control group. The experimental group was given inquiry based Observatin of physic phenomena model and the control group was given the direct intructions model. The research instrument was multiple choice tests measuring science generic skills, analytical test to measure cognitive abilities of physic sciences, and LKS and observer assessment to measure students during the learning activity using the models. The data was analyzed by using t – test. The hypothesis of this study is that; 1)the inquiry based observation of physic phenomena model can significantly influence the science generic skills, 2) the inquiry based observation of physic phenomena model can significantly influence the cognitive abilities of physic science. Based on the results, Ha is accepted if p significance  0,05 and Ha is rejected if p > 0,05. Results of this study were, 1)the p significance significance value of science generic skills is 0,000  0,05 is outside the acceptance of Ha; 2)the p value of cognitive abilities of physic science is 0,000 0,05 is outside the acceptance of Ha dan; 3)activity of students using the model of inquiry based observation of physic phenomene in the range 60% <77% <80% classified as Active. This study can be concluded that; 1)the inquiry based observation of physic phenomena model can significantly influence the science generic skills, 2) the inquiry based observation of physic phenomena model can significantly influence the cognitive abilities of physic science, and 3) activity of students using the model of inquiry based observation of physic phenomena classified of Active.
